html,body
{
	margin:0px;
	padding:0px;
	background-color: #4D5049;
	width:100%;
	height:100%;
	color:#010200;
	font-family :Arial;
	font-size:11px;
	
}


#mainContainer
{
	background-color: #FFFFFF;
	width:980px;
	position: relative;
	text-align:left;
	
}


#contentContainer
{
	
	position: relative;
	float:left;
	width:952px;
	
}

#centreContainer
{
	/*position: relative;*/
	width:952px;
	background-image: url(/template/image/fondColonneMenu.jpg);
	background-repeat:repeat-y;
	
}

#menuContainer
{
	width:162px;
	background-color: #7CB854;
	position: relative;
	float : left;
	height:300px;


}

#colDroite
{
	width:158px;
	position: relative;
	float : left;
}

#lienContainer
{
	width:158px;
	position: relative;
	float : left;
	background-color: #C0CEE4;
}

#espace
{
	height: 14px;

}

#espaceGauche
{
	width: 44px;
	position: relative;
	float : left;
}

#espaceDroite
{
	width: 25px;
	position: relative;
	float : left;
}

#centreTxt
{
	width: 563px;
	/*position: relative;*/
	float : left;

	
}

#bandeau
{
	width:952;
	height:233;
	background-image: url(/template/themes/T1/image/bandeau.jpg);
	background-repeat:no-repeat;
	position:relative;

}

#langContainer
{
	width:952;
	text-align:right;
	height:215;

}

#menuFixe
{
	float:left;
	background-color:white;
	font-size:11px;
	color:#7CB854;
	height:15px;
	padding-left:10px;
	padding-right:10px;
	padding-top:3px;
	
}

.txtmenuFixe
{
	font-size:12px;
	color:#7CB854;
	text-decoration:none;
	padding-right:5px;
}

.txtmenuFixeOn
{
	font-size:12px;
	color:#308D34;
	text-decoration:none;
	padding-right:5px;
}

.txtmenuFixeSelect
{
	font-size:12px;
	color:#308D34;
	text-decoration:none;
	padding-right:5px;
	font-weight:bold;
}


#pageContent, #moduleContent
{
	/*position : relative;*/
	float: left;
}


#contentIcone
{
	height:20px;
	text-align:right;
}

#contentSearch
{
	height:100px;
}

#contentLinks
{
	background-color : #C0CEE4;
	height:155px;
	
}

.TitreLiens
{
	color:#C0CEE4;
	font-size:16px;
	padding-bottom:15px;
	letter-spacing:1px;
	
}

.divwrapper
{
	position:relative;
	clear:both;
}


.divMargeCote
{
	width:14px;
	background-color: #FFFFFF;
	float:left;
	heigth:100%;
	
}

.divMargeTop
{
	height:14px;
	background-color: #FFFFFF;
	width:100%;
}

.MenuOn
{
	font-weight:bold;
	text-decoration:none;
	background-repeat:no-repeat;
	
}

.MenuOff
{
	font-weight:normal;
	text-decoration:none;
	
}


label
{
    COLOR: #707070;
    FONT-FAMILY: Arial;
    FONT-SIZE: 11px;
}

/*Creation des style ici parce que j'ai besoin des variables*/


  .selectedThumb
  {
    border: solid 1px #7CB854;
  }

  .txt_error
  {
  color : red;
  }

.TableCarte
{

border: 4px outset #999999;
}

.bordCarte
{
BORDER-RIGHT: #999999 1px solid;
}

.pg_resume
{
font-weight:bold;
color : #7CB854;
}

.pg_content
{
	font-size:11px;
}

.bgEditor
{
background-color: #FFFFFF;
min-height:358;


}

TABLE
{
  FONT-SIZE: 11px;

}

.tableauRessource
{
  FONT-SIZE: 11px;
  TEXT-ALIGN: left;
}

TD
{


}
.erreur

{
    COLOR: red;
    FONT-FAMILY: Arial;
    FONT-SIZE: 11px;
    TEXT-ALIGN: justify;

}
.admin_buttonFS
{
    BORDER-TOP: #999999 1px solid;
    BORDER-BOTTOM: #999999 1px solid;
    BORDER-LEFT: #999999 1px solid;
    BORDER-RIGHT: #999999 1px solid;
    BACKGROUND-COLOR: #ECE9D8 ;
    COLOR: black;
    FONT-FAMILY: Arial;
    FONT-SIZE: 11px;
}
.admin_buttonFile
{
    BORDER-TOP: #999999 1px solid;
    BORDER-BOTTOM: #999999 1px solid;
    BORDER-LEFT: #999999 1px solid;
    BORDER-RIGHT: #999999 1px solid;
    BACKGROUND-COLOR: #FFFFFF ;
    COLOR: black;
    FONT-FAMILY: Arial;
    FONT-SIZE: 11px;
}

.admin_button
{
    BORDER-TOP: #999999 1px solid;
    BORDER-BOTTOM: #999999 1px solid;
    BORDER-LEFT: #999999 1px solid;
    BORDER-RIGHT: #999999 1px solid;
    BACKGROUND-COLOR: #FFFFFF ;
    COLOR: black;
    FONT-FAMILY: Arial;
    FONT-SIZE: 11px;
}


.admin_td
{
    COLOR: black;
    FONT-FAMILY: Arial;
    FONT-SIZE: 11px;
    padding-right:5px;
    padding-left:5px;
    vertical-align:top;
}

hr
{
	color:#707070;
	height:1px;
}

input
{
    BORDER-TOP:   1px solid;
    BORDER-BOTTOM:  1px solid;
    BORDER-LEFT:   1px solid;
    BORDER-RIGHT:  1px solid;
    border-color:#707070;
    BACKGROUND-COLOR: white ;
    COLOR: black;
    FONT-FAMILY: Arial;
    FONT-SIZE: 11px;
}

textarea
{
    BORDER-TOP:  1px solid;
    BORDER-BOTTOM:  1px solid;
    BORDER-LEFT:  1px solid;
    BORDER-RIGHT:  1px solid;
    BACKGROUND-COLOR: white;
    border-color: #707070;
    color:black;
    FONT-FAMILY: Arial;
    FONT-SIZE: 11px;
}


.News_title
{
    FONT-WEIGHT: bold;
    FONT-SIZE: 11px;
    COLOR: #014F8B;
    TEXT-DECORATION: none ;
}

.searchInput
{


Border:0px;
COLOR:#FFFFFF;
Font-size:9px;
background:transparent;


}

.btnSearch
{
	border:0px;
}

.search_txt
{
    FONT-WEIGHT: none;
    FONT-SIZE: 11px;
    COLOR: #999999;
}


.News_resume
{
    FONT-SIZE: 9px;
    COLOR: #010200;
    TEXT-DECORATION: none ;
}
.News_date
{
    FONT-SIZE: 9px;
    COLOR: #50505	0;
    TEXT-DECORATION: none ;
}


.admin_form
{
    PADDING: 0px 0px 0px 0px;
    MARGIN: 0px 0px 0px 0px;
}

.admin_combo
{
	border:0px;
    BACKGROUND-COLOR: white;
    border-color: #707070;
    COLOR: black;
    font-size:11px;
    FONT-FAMILY: Arial;
}

.admin_icon
{
    FONT-SIZE: 11px;
    FONT-FAMILY: Arial;
    background-color: transparent;
    border-style: none
}

.admin_scroll
{
    OVERFLOW-Y: auto;
    FONT-SIZE: 11px;
    FLOAT: left;
    WIDTH: 300px;
    FONT-FAMILY: Arial, Helvetica, sans-serif;
    POSITION: relative;
    HEIGHT: 350px;
    BACKGROUND-COLOR: white
}
.admin_check
{
    FONT-SIZE: 7px;
    FONT-FAMILY: Arial;
    background-color: transparent;
    border-style: none
}

.admin_title
{
    PADDING-LEFT: 0px;
    FONT-WEIGHT: bold;
    FONT-SIZE: 11px;
    COLOR: #010200;
}

H1
{
    PADDING-LEFT: 0px;
    FONT-SIZE: 14px;
    COLOR: #010200;
    FONT-WEIGHT: normal;
    text-transform:uppercase;
}

H2
{
    MARGIN-BOTTOM: 10px;
    PADDING-LEFT: 0px;
    FONT-WEIGHT: bold;
    FONT-SIZE: 12px;
    COLOR: #7CB854;
}

H3
{
    MARGIN-BOTTOM: 6px;
    PADDING-LEFT: 0px;
    FONT-WEIGHT: bold;
    FONT-SIZE: 11px;
    COLOR: #010200;
}

H4
{
    MARGIN-BOTTOM: 6px;
    PADDING-LEFT: 0px;
    FONT-WEIGHT: bold;
    FONT-SIZE: 11px;
    COLOR: #7CB854;
}

P
{
    FONT-FAMILY: Arial;
    FONT-SIZE: 11px;
    MARGIN-TOP: 7px;
    MARGIN-BOTTOM: 7px;

}

#adresse
{
	color : #FFFFFF;
	margin-left:10px;
	text-decoration:none;
	font-size:11px;
	bottom:15px;
	position:absolute;
	
	
}



.pg_title
{
    PADDING-LEFT: 0px;
    FONT-WEIGHT: bold;
    FONT-SIZE: 16px;
    COLOR: #010200;
}

.pg_date
{
	FONT-WEIGHT: bold;
}


A
{
    FONT-SIZE: 11px;
    COLOR: #7CB854;
    TEXT-DECORATION: underline;
}

.A_Selected
{
  FONT-SIZE: 11px;
  COLOR: #7CB854;
  TEXT-DECORATION: none;
}

.LienSimple
{
    FONT-SIZE: 11px;
    COLOR: #C0CEE4;
    TEXT-DECORATION: none;


}

.LienSimpleSelect
{
    FONT-SIZE: 11px;
    COLOR: #F5F7F9;
    TEXT-DECORATION: none;
	font-weight:bold;

}

.Footer
{
    FONT-SIZE: 10px;
    COLOR: #999999;
    TEXT-DECORATION: none;


}

/*Permet de gérer les différents niveaux du menu pour fair la liaison entre les langues*/
.sm0
{
    FONT-SIZE: 13px;
    COLOR: #7CB854;
    MARGIN-TOP: 0px;
    MARGIN-BOTTOM: 0px;
    MARGIN-LEFT: 20px;

}

.sm1
{
    FONT-SIZE: 13px;
    COLOR: #7CB854;
    MARGIN-BOTTOM: -2px;
    MARGIN-TOP: -2px;
    MARGIN-LEFT: 40px;

}

.sm2
{
    FONT-SIZE: 10px;
    COLOR: #7CB854;
    MARGIN-BOTTOM: -4px;
    MARGIN-TOP: -4px;
    MARGIN-LEFT: 60px;

}

.sm3
{
    FONT-SIZE: 9px;
    COLOR: #7CB854;
    MARGIN-BOTTOM: -4px;
    MARGIN-TOP: -4px;
    MARGIN-LEFT: 80px;

}


/*Style pour les listes*/
.liste_keyword
{
	HEIGHT: 30px;
	FONT-WEIGHT: bold;
  	VERTICAL-ALIGN: bottom;
  	color : #308D34;
}

.liste_date
{
  	VERTICAL-ALIGN: top;
  	color: #A4A4A5;
}

.liste_titreLiens
{
 	FONT-WEIGHT: bold;
    FONT-SIZE: 11px;
    COLOR: #204575;
    TEXT-DECORATION: none ;
    text-transform:uppercase;
}

.liste_titre
{
 	FONT-WEIGHT: bold;
    FONT-SIZE: 11px;
    COLOR: #2D8C38;
    TEXT-DECORATION: none ;
}

.liste_resume
{
 	FONT-SIZE: 11px;
 	color :#010200;
}

.liste_resumeLiens
{
 	FONT-SIZE: 11px;
 	color :#204575;
}

.liste_separator
{
  HEIGHT: 5px;
}

.btnTransparent
{
background-color:transparent;
border:0;
text-align:left;
cursor:pointer;
}

.liste_keywordCat
{
	HEIGHT: 30px;
	FONT-WEIGHT: bold;
  	VERTICAL-ALIGN: bottom;
  	PADDING-BOTTOM:5px;
  	PADDING-TOP:17px;
}

.lnk_youarehere
{

	color:#A4A4A5;
	
}

#youAreHere
{
	padding-bottom:15px;
	font-size:10px;
	margin:0px;
	padding:0px;
	
}


/*flipflop keyword*/
.keywordFlipFlopSelect{
	width: 250px ;
	height: 85px ;

}
.keywordFlipFlopSelectliens{
	width: 400px ;
	height: 100px ;

}

.keywordFlipFlopTable{
	width: 0px ;
	height: 00px ;
}

.keywordFlipFlopButtonSel{
	width : 20px ;
	/*background-color: rgb(255,255,255);
	color:#CC071E;
	border-style: ridge;
	font-size: 11px;
	vertical-align:center;*/
	background-color:#2D8C38;
border:1 solid;
border-color: #2D8C38;
color:white;
text-align:center;
cursor:pointer;
font-size:11px;
}
.keywordFlipFlopButtonSelliens{

	background-color:transparent;
	border:0;
	vertical-align:center;
}

.flip_flop_keyword
{
    width: 150;
    height: 110;
}

.flip_flop_button_sel
{
    width: 32;
    height: 26;
}

.flip_flop_button_sort
{
    width: 30;
    height: 24;
}


/*GOOGLE API AJAX*/
/*DIV de resultat*/
#searchresult .gs-result{margin-bottom : 15px;} 
#searchresult .gs-snippet{} 
#searchresult .gs-visibleUrl-short{display:none;}
#searchresult .gs-visibleUrl-long{display:none;} 
#searchresult a.gs-title{} 
#searchresult a.gs-title * {font-weight:bold;} 
#searchresult div.gs-watermark{display: none;} 
/* Pagination: trailing cursor section */
.gsc-results .gsc-cursor{display : inline;}
.gsc-results .gsc-cursor-box {margin-bottom : 10px;}
.gsc-results .gsc-cursor-box .gsc-cursor-page 
{
  cursor : pointer;
  text-decoration: underline;
  margin-right : 8px;
  display : inline;
}
/* Style pour le numero de page selectionne */ 
.gsc-results .gsc-cursor-box .gsc-cursor-current-page
{
  text-decoration: none;
  font-weight:bold;
}
/* Style pour le numero de page selectionne */ 
.gsc-results .gsc-cursor-box .gsc-trailing-more-results 
{
  margin-bottom : 0px;
  display : inline;
}

